1) Divide-by-zero (CVE-ID: CVE-2018-14394)
The vulnerability allows a remote unauthenticated attacker to cause DoS condition.
The vulnerability exists due to boundary error when the ff_mov_write_packet() function, as defined in the libavformat/movenc.c source code file of the affected software, is used. A remote attacker can trick the victim into opening a specially crafted WAV file that submits malicious input, trigger a divide-by-zero error and cause the service to crash.
